It worth re-iterating that the gloss varnish step is really important (for any decals) as this smooths the surface and stops tiny air bubbles forming under the decal, this can lead to the silvery look of sometimes seen with decals.
For very small decals, rather than using a pot of water, I sometimes just put the decal on my cutting board, and add a drop of water on top of the decal. Stops it floating away.
